From d9f1a50cc17fafb156d5f8bf507abae1650b6256 Mon Sep 17 00:00:00 2001 From: Christian Kolb Date: Mon, 3 Jun 2024 08:58:48 +0200 Subject: [PATCH] Fix changelog and frozen clock initialization (#50) Co-authored-by: Christian Kolb --- CHANGELOG.md | 2 +- src/Clock/FrozenClock.php |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 644249a..f1734c8 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-2,7 +2,7 @@ ## 0.11.0 -- Added `Clock` implementation with `SystemClock` and `FixedClock`. +- Added `Clock` implementation with `SystemClock` and `FrozenClock`. ## 0.10.0 diff --git a/src/Clock/FrozenClock.php b/src/Clock/FrozenClock.php index fabaed8..5d5bd56 100644 --- a/src/Clock/FrozenClock.php +++ b/src/Clock/FrozenClock.php @@ -12,7 +12,7 @@ final class FrozenClock implements Clock public function __construct(?Moment $moment = null) { - $this->moment = $moment ?? Moment::fromDateTime(new \DateTimeImmutable('now')); + $this->moment = $moment ?? Moment::fromString('now'); } public function freeze(Moment $moment): void